Business, Management & Marketing Schools in Iowa

9,055 students earned Business, Management & Marketing degrees in Iowa in the 2022-2023 year.

As a degree choice, Business, Management & Marketing is the 2nd most popular major in the state.

Jobs for Business, Management & Marketing Grads in Iowa

In this state, there are 352,410 people employed in jobs related to a business, management & marketing degree, compared to 34,973,960 nationwide.

Wages for Business, Management & Marketing Jobs in Iowa

In this state, business, management & marketing grads earn an average of $63,290. Nationwide, they make an average of $69,480.
